(Fort Washington, PA, Friday, February 3, 2017) – “Super Monday,” the day after the big game and big-time eating, has become a national phenomenon and one of the top days of the year for men to start diets. What’s behind the trend and what’s your game plan?

Super Bowl Sunday is expected to be the busiest day in the pizza business and the second largest food consumption day behind Thanksgiving. During the course of the game, the average football fan is expected to eat 1,200 calories and 50 grams of fat solely in snacks. So, all this calls for a game plan on “Super Monday” (the day after the big game) when men will call or visit Nutrisystem.com every 1.5 seconds making it one of the top ten diet decision days of the year.
